This is a request for information pursuant to the Freedom of Information Act 2000.

I wondered if you could kindly supply me with details of the following:

1. The total amount the council has paid in loans to commercial and residential property developers for development schemes within its jurisdiction, broken down over the past five financial years (2009/10, 10/11, 11/12, 12/13, 13/14).
2. The total number of loans, broken down over the same years as above.
3. Returns on the loans/expected returns.
4. Details on each individual loan – size of loan; what scheme it applied to; type of scheme (residential, retail, office, industrial, mixed-use); the developer involved; jobs created.

This is not a witch-hunt, waste of taxpayers’ money-type story. On the contrary, it is a story on how council loans have helped developers get their schemes off the ground (particularly during the recession) thus benefiting the local economy, creating jobs.

Brighton and Hove City Council

Brighton & Hove City Council has not provided any loans to any commercial or residential property developers in the last five financial years.
